HOW TO CALIBRATE A DIGITAL SCALE

Although most digital scales are calibrated before shipping, due to different gravity in different part of the globe, a from-time-to-time calibration will keep your scale always accurate.

In the status of OFF, hold both TARE key and MODE key and press ON/OFF button and release all buttons when the screen shows “CAL”. Hereinafter the screen will show a negative figure, which is its internal code. Wait until the internal code stays on a certain figure, press the MODE button and the screen shows “ZERO” and then internal code. Put standard weight on the platform. (Please refer to the following standard weight for your model)

Standard Calibration Weight:

Model DW-150BX

150 gram Class 4 and up

Model DW-250BX

250 gram Class 4 and up

Model DW-350BX

350 gram Class 4 and up

Model DW-500BX

500 gram Class 4 and up

Wait until the internal code stays on a certain figure, press the MODE button, the screen shows weight of the standard weight then shows “PASS” and then weight of the standard weight again. Press ON/OFF button to switch off the scale. Calibration is completed.

Calibration is needed periodically for most digital scales, digital food scales, digital postal scales.
